The scope of legal protection for listed buildings
This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.
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.
For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details
NY 65 SE KNARESDALE WITH KIRKHAUGH SLAGGYFORD
12/249 Slaggyford Station
II
Former Railway Station. Mid Cl9. Squared rubble with ashlar dressings; Welsh slate roof. 2 storeys, 3 bays, symmetrical. Central bay projects with half-glazed door under pedimented hood. 2-light mullioned window, each light an 8-pane sash, above, and steeply-pitched coped gable with kneelers. Flanking bays have similar 2-light windows. All openings have chamfered surrounds. Coped gables with kneelers. Ashlar end stacks have paired corniced chimneys set diagonally. Left return shows similar mullioned windows. To right single-storey former waiting room has later wood porch and C19 sash to right; right end stack with paired square corniced chimneys. The Alston branch of the Newcastle-Carlisle railway was opened in 1852'
